    The difference between silicon-carbon and Li-ion batteries

    Rather of being a completely novel idea, today’s silicon-carbon (Si/C) Li-Ion batteries are essentially an advancement of conventional lithium-ion technology. By adding silicon, which has a substantially higher energy storage capacity than graphite (372 mAh/g compared to about 4200 mAh/g for pure silicon), they alter the traditional graphite anode. Because of this, silicon has long been a promising material for increasing battery capacity.

    Pure silicon anodes, however, face many difficulties. Extreme expansion is the most troublesome; when fully charged, the structure can inflate by up to 300%. The battery experiences extreme mechanical stress as a result, shortening its lifespan and leading to structural breakdown.

    Over time, lithium loss and decreased capacity result from silicon’s strong reaction with the electrolyte, which breaks and reforms the Solid Electrolyte Interphase (SEI) layer with each cycle. The aggressive expansion exacerbates this. Another drawback for battery longevity is that silicon has lesser electrical conductivity than graphite, which can reduce charge and discharge rates and increase losses from internal resistance. This can lead to increased heat.

    To address these problems, a silicon-carbon (Si/C) composite is utilized rather than pure silicon. The SEI layer is stabilized and its expansion is lessened by the structural support that carbon offers. Depending on its silicon concentration, a well-designed Si/C battery may restrict swelling to just 10–20% during charge cycles, whereas conventional graphite anodes only increase by about 10%. Additionally, carbon increases electrical conductivity, which guarantees better lithium-ion flow and higher efficiency.

    The trade-off is that Si/C anodes are unable to fully realize the 10x capacity improvement of pure silicon. Rather, depending on the silicon percentage, they provide a very modest energy density increase of 10–20%. Si/C batteries are an engineering problem since higher Si content enhances capacity but also causes swelling and complicates manufacture. There are restrictions and trade-offs associated with Si/C batteries, but there is no such thing as a free lunch.

    The pros and cons for silicon carbon batteries

    silicon carbon battery

    Any increase in smartphone battery capacity is obviously beneficial, and Si/C batteries are a godsend for power users who want devices that can endure much longer than a single day of intensive usage. It should come as no surprise that so many of the most potent flagship phones available this year have the technology.

    After more than a month of everyday use, I can vouch for the OPPO Find X8 Pro’s 5,910mAh Si/C Li-ion battery’s exceptional longevity. I frequently get two days of moderate use out of a single charge, have enough of fuel left over after a day of chasing the kids, and in lighter weeks, I have occasionally gone well into 48 hours without needing a charger.

    On the other hand, Si/C is advantageous for thinner gadgets, such lightweight and foldable phones. Thin or small smartphones could surely benefit from this new battery type to maintain decent capacities in more constrained form factors, even though the Galaxy S25 Edge might not be Samsung’s first Si/C smartphone.

    The technology has already been used to fit a sizable 5,700mAh battery into a 5.2mm folding design in the Vivo X Fold 3 Pro. Despite being 5.6 mm thick, Samsung’s Z Fold 6 only contains a standard 4,400mA battery. This trend toward higher capacities has also been embraced by the latest Chinese clamshell phones.

    Whether silicon-carbon batteries will outlast their more conventional lithium equivalents is the main question that remains. It is evident from the foregoing trade-offs that Si/C will not outlast the most robust graphite-based Li-ion cells now available on the market. Lower silicon concentration can nonetheless provide batteries with a marginally larger capacity that have a comparable lifespan to conventional Li-ion cells. With only a slight but welcome increase in capacity to control the silicon content, this appears to be what we are seeing in today’s most advanced smartphones.

    Because Si/C batteries are pushing the limits of energy density and charge rates, smartphone manufacturers may also be becoming more cautious when it comes to fast-charging temperatures in an effort to prolong battery lifespans. In other words, manufacturers are merely attempting to make sure their phones can withstand the promised updates for the next five or more years. But because of its increased capacity, stronger diffusivity of lithium, and decreased chance of plating the anode, Si/C is actually a godsend for faster charging. Additionally, bigger capacities make it easier to follow the 80% charge guideline without worrying about running out of juice in the middle of the day. If you want to keep your phone for many years to come, silicon need not be a negative thing.

    Why a silicon-carbon battery device is a good choice?

    The newest smartphones will undoubtedly benefit from Si/C Li-ion batteries, which will also likely extend the battery life of your wearables, tablets, laptops, and even electric cars. The most cutting-edge phones of today already heavily rely on silicon cells, which allow for even greater capacities or slimmer form factors without sacrificing battery life.

    But at the moment, you will need to look around at Chinese companies to find one, like the OnePlus 13, which is very amazing. Apple, Google, and Samsung, three US giants, have not yet embraced this new battery technology. We may have to wait until their 2026 flagships or even later before they join the celebration, as they might not even get around to it this year.

    However, if you intend to retain your smartphone for more than five years, it might be wise to wait and see how the longevity issue develops. Any long-term purchase will eventually require battery replacements, but Si/C Li-ion cells may require more frequent replacements, particularly when fast charging is used. This can turn out to be an unwanted extra expense for early adopters because they are more costly to make. We will need to wait and find out.

    Why Xiaomi 15 Ultra missed the top?

    DXOMark reports that the phone has trouble with visible abnormalities that affect image quality, contrast irregularities, and sporadic warm color casts in both images and videos. Additionally, there are problems with autofocus stepping and texture degradation under some circumstances, which can make focusing less fluid.

    Its limited depth of field, which causes blurry background faces in group photos, is another significant flaw. Keep in mind that its primary camera is the source of this limitation.

    These flaws could be disappointing for a phone that strives to be the finest of the best. Despite these figures, the 15 Ultra still has some of the best mobile camera hardware on the market.

    More devices may now use live photos thanks to Xiaomi HyperOS 2.

    The cross-ecosystem LivePhoto transmission compatibility of HyperOS 2 was formally revealed by Xiaomi, enabling smooth live photo sharing between Xiaomi phones, Xiaomi Pads, iPhones, and iPads. Grayscale mode is supported, and the feature is progressively being made available in batches.

    The enhancement is one of the actions Xiaomi is taking to create a comprehensive ecosystem that will provide a more seamless experience across devices. For optimal compatibility, users who are interested in the functionality should update their smartphones to the most recent versions of Xiaomi Photo Album and Xiaomi Share.Xiaomi HyperOS is always evolving, providing consumers with fresh and creative features to enhance their convenience.

    LivePhoto Cross-Ecosystem Support Details

    Sharing dynamic pics in the LivePhoto format while maintaining their motion effects is now possible with Xiaomi HyperOS 2. Users can now share and enjoy LivePhotos on both Xiaomi and Apple devices with ease thanks to the latest update, which was revealed in the official Q&A (Episode 8) for Xiaomi HyperOS on March 7.

    How to use live photo transfer

    For successful transmission of LivePhotos, users must meet the following requirements:

    • Both devices must be on the same wireless LAN – The sending and receiving devices need to be on the same wireless local area network.
    • The applications must be upgraded to certain versions – Apple and Xiaomi devices must have the latest software upgrades to be able to support this.
    xiaomi live photos

    App Versions Required

    • Xiaomi Phones and Pads:
      • Xiaomi Share3.6.2 and later
      • Xiaomi Photo Album: Version 4.2.0.8 and above
    • Apple Devices (iPhone and iPad):
      • Xiaomi Internet Service: Version 1.3 and later
